Jeff Bridges closed his set last night with a Dylan cover — “The Man In Me”, best known as the opening song in The Big Lebowski, a movie that turned a very talented actor into a cult hero. After picking up a Best Actor Oscar for his recent turn as washed up country musician Bad Blake in Crazy Heart, Bridges has decided to dive head first back into music and release a solo album on a major label, EMI’s Blue Note Records.

I was lucky enough to be at the Troubadour last night where he played a set to family (including his brother Beau), friends, fellow musicians and lots of industry folk (if only they would stop talking!). He blamed T Bone Burnett for his foray into music but seemed totally at home on the stage. Quincy Jones genuinely and lovingly introduced him to the crowd and Bridges was grinning from the moment he walked on stage to the moment he left, calling the show “surreal”.

Very few people get to live out their rock star dreams – and very few people do it well, as Bridges did last night, surrounded by a band of expert players.  (He lives in Santa Barbara and was worried about putting together a band, but said his players “were the first guys to show up”) As always seems to be the case, his vibe dictated everything. He is cool no matter what he does, even if he takes a few minutes too long to tune a guitar. He seems so at ease with everything, that you’re at ease too, which makes for a delightful evening.

It was great to hear tracks from Crazy Heart like “The Weary Kind” and “Fallin’ and Flyin’” and many of the songwriters who worked on the movie wrote material for the new album.  The catchy first single “What A Little Bit of Love Can Do” is a lot of  fun and “Blue Car” had a nice groove.

His self-titled new album will be out August 16 and while there aren’t any tour dates planned yet — apparently he’s heading off to shoot another movie — look out for them in the future.
